garner

gar·ner [ grnər ] (past and past participle gar·nered, present participle gar·ner·ing, 3rd person present singular gar·ners)


transitive verb 
Definition:
 
1. win or gain something: to earn or acquire something by effort

2. gather information: to collect or accumulate something such as information or facts

3. gather in something: to gather something into storage or into a granary

[12th century. Via Anglo-Norman gerner "storehouse" < Latin granarium (see granary)]
